999精品在线视频,手机成人午夜在线视频,久久不卡国产精品无码,中日无码在线观看,成人av手机在线观看,日韩精品亚洲一区中文字幕,亚洲av无码人妻,四虎国产在线观看 ?

WMS與WCS系統交互數據結構設計

2017-07-10 10:28:11楊巨峰張志杰
物流技術 2017年6期
關鍵詞:定義數據庫信息

楊巨峰,張志杰,嚴 銳

(運城學院,山西 運城 044000)

WMS與WCS系統交互數據結構設計

楊巨峰,張志杰,嚴 銳

(運城學院,山西 運城 044000)

梳理了具有自動輸送分揀線、手持終端RF輔助揀選與電子標簽輔助揀選DPS系統智能化設備的倉庫管理系統WMS與倉儲設備控制系統WCS間的交互業務,進而對信息接口進行分析定義:從周轉箱/托盤集裝單元信息方面、揀貨任務、分揀等方面確定交互信息內容,然后從WMS下傳WCS、WCS回傳WMS以及交互完成狀態等方面對接口任務數據表的字段名稱、字段類型、輸入值、字段作用等信息進行分析定義,為現代化倉儲管理系統項目集成提供建議。

WMS;WCS;接口交互;數據任務表

1 引言

隨著市場對倉儲需求的提高,倉儲管理逐步利用信息管理系統與自動化設備提高其運轉與管理水平。智能化倉儲是指自動輸送分揀系統、電子標簽輔助揀選系統DPS、自動立體庫系統RS/AS、自動導航搬運車AGV、碼垛機器人、倉儲管理系統WMS與倉儲設備控制系統WCS等一體化的應用。WMS為庫內作業流程與物流信息管理軟件,下發入庫與出庫指令后,眾多庫內自動化設備根據信息指令啟動工作,但WMS專注庫內物流信息管理,不能直接驅動眾多自動設備,并且眾多設備的工作順序需要進行調度,必須要有設備控制管理層,即倉儲設備控制系統WCS作為業務管理信息與設備指令銜接層[1],直接決定倉儲作業信息與設備轉接關系,從而影響智能化倉儲信息與設備一體化程度。倉儲WMS與WCS系統分別為獨立應用系統[2],整個智能化倉儲運轉的穩定與WMS、WCS系統間接口交互有重大關系。在兩大系統融通方面,主要問題為接口交互信息傳遞,有必要對WMS與WCS間的交互信息進行詳細分析。通過對智能化倉儲信息層與交互流程的梳理,對接口數據傳遞信息表項進行定義,為倉儲信息系統集成工程提供一定依據。

由于WCS可以對接較多的智能化倉儲設備,本文就WCS控制自動輸送分揀線、手持RF揀貨系統、電子標簽輔助揀選系統DPS的出庫作業下分析WMS與WCS間的交互數據關系。

2 WMS、WCS及設備控制系統信息交互梳理

2.1 信息交互流程

WMS與WCS系統間信息交互通過數據庫表項內容進行連接,交互傳遞分為WMS下傳WCS信息與WCS回傳WMS信息。為了保護WMS與WCS自身數據安全,接口通過數據庫中間表的方式來實現,不直接對雙方系統數據庫進行讀寫,WMS將任務直接寫入數據庫中間表或WCS將數據回傳至數據庫中間表。定義下傳中間庫表名為inter_wms_task,回傳中間庫表名為inter_wcs_task與任務完成庫表名inter_finish。在確定下傳與回傳數據表內容時,需要對WMS與WCS間的交互業務進行梳理。配備自動化輸送線系統、電子標簽輔助揀選系統與手持RF揀選系統等智能化倉儲出庫作業時的WMS與WCS間業務交互過程如圖1。

2.2 接口說明

為了保證WMS和WCS系統的基礎數據與運行數據安全,兩者間的接口通過數據庫中間表的方式來實現,中間表建立在WMS系統Oracle或SQL數據庫上[3]。WMS將任務直接寫入數據庫中間表。WCS采用DAO(Data Access Object)的方式訪問WMS數據庫中間表;DAO是事務對象,每一個被DAO執行的操作都是和事務相關聯的。WCS接收WMS下發任務的處理過程作為一個整體,在處理過程中所有語句都成功執行后事務處理成功;當WCS接收任務失敗,則整個處理失敗,并恢復到處理前的狀態。

(1)WMS下發任務至WCS接口處理。WMS在inter_wms_task(WMS數據庫)中寫入新的出庫任務,WCS接收后刪除至備份表inter_wms_task_bak(WMS備份數據庫)。

(2)周轉箱自動注冊信息的處理。周轉箱進行自動注冊,WCS進行虛擬載體編號與實際載體編號的對應,記錄到任務信息中,回傳對應周轉箱注冊信息給與WMS至inter_wcs_task(WMS數據庫),WMS接收注冊信息后刪除至備份表inter_wcs_task_bak(WMS備份數據庫)。

(3)WCS回傳揀貨完成任務至WMS接口處理。WCS完成揀貨操作,在表inter_wcs_task(WMS數據庫)寫入完成信息,WMS接收完成信息后刪除至備份表inter_wcs_task_bak(WMS備份數據庫)。

(4)RF揀貨、WMS復核完成信息傳送表。WMS在inter_finish(WMS數據庫)中寫入新的出入庫任務,WCS接收后刪除至備份表inter_finish_bak(WMS備份數據庫)。

2.3 確定交互信息

在WMS與WCS系統交互過程中,信息項內容較多。針對單個揀選訂單任務,WMS與WCS交互的信息內容分為下傳與回傳信息項。根據WMS與WCS間信息交互過程分析,下傳信息項包括周轉箱/托盤集裝單元信息、揀貨任務信息、分揀信息。具體包括:

(1)周轉箱/托盤集裝單元信息:包括手動注冊信息、虛擬集裝單元編碼。(2)揀貨任務信息:揀貨起止時間、揀貨任務優先級別信息、揀貨單號、訂單行信息、揀貨數量、商品材積量、源貨位基礎地址編碼[4]。(3)分揀信息:配送線路或區域信息、派送員信息。

WCS回傳WMS信息項包括已經分配任務周轉箱/托盤集裝單元信息、揀貨執行任務信息、分揀信息、庫存賬務處理信息。具體包括:(1)周轉箱/托盤集裝單元信息包括:綁定任務的周轉箱/托盤集裝單元編碼。(2)揀貨任務信息:揀貨員信息、源貨位入口號、源貨位揀貨地址編碼、揀貨數量。(3)分揀信息:包裝條碼信息。

3 接口表數據結構定義

根據WMS與WCS系統交互業務內容,逐一定義接口數據項。

3.1 WMS到WCS新任務接口表定義

關于WMS到WCS新任務接口表(INTER_WMS_TASK)方面,分別定義:

(1)周轉箱/托盤集裝單元信息方面。①周轉箱號/托盤號palno,定義字段類型為Varchar(20),WMS手動注冊后需要走輸送線的,則WMS下發實際注冊物流箱號。②是否啟動輸送線isbar,定義字段類型為varchar(5),0值表示WCS自動注冊,1值表示WMS手動注冊。

(2)揀貨任務信息方面。①任務編號taskid,定義字段類型為Varchar(20),該字段為WMS到WCS新任務接口表(INTER_WMS_TASK)主關鍵字。②源貨位地址resaddre,定義字段類型為Varchar(20),周轉箱出庫操作中源貨位地址為揀貨貨位地址;庫存盤點操作中源貨位地址為盤點貨位地址,不為空值。③源貨位入口resport,定義字段類型為Varchar(6),該字段與源貨位地址resaddre為一對多關系,周轉箱出庫操作時,源貨位地址確定后入口resport即時確定,下傳確定輸送線中周轉箱彈出口;庫存盤點操作中源貨位入口沒有意義,為空值。④作業操作類型optype,定義字段類型為varchar(5),BO:周轉箱出庫PD:庫存盤點。出庫數量quant,定義字段類型為Int。⑤實際出庫數量backquant,定義字段類型為Int,下發時候默認為0。⑥當前揀貨總行數Linecount,定義字段類型為Int,當前揀貨任務總行數,不為空值。⑦揀貨完成finish,定義字段類型為varchar(5),0值表示完成,1值表示周轉箱有漏揀任務行。⑧揀貨員IDUserid,定義字段類型為Varchar(20),內容為空值,等待回傳數據。

(3)分揀信息方面。①客戶IDcustomerid,定義字段類型為Varchar(20),接收鍵入內容,下傳(INTER_WCS_TASK)任務表。②派送路徑或區域Sendkind,定義字段類型為Varchar(20),該字段在進行路徑分揀時不存在,接收鍵入內容,下傳(INTER_WCS_TASK)任務表。

3.2 WCS到WMS回傳任務接口表定義

WCS回傳WMS新任務接口表(INTER_WCS_TASK)方面,分別定義:

(1)周轉箱/托盤集裝單元信息方面。①周轉箱號/托盤號palno,定義字段類型為Varchar(20),需要自動注冊周轉箱的任務,這個字段下發的時候為空字符串,輸送線掃描周轉箱獲取條形碼通過WCS回傳WMS,分配揀選任務。②是否啟動輸送線isbar,定義字段類型為varchar(5),0值表示WCS自動注冊,1值表示WMS手動注冊。

(2)揀貨任務信息。①任務編號taskid,定義字段類型為Varchar(20),接收下傳信息,該字段為WCS回傳WMS新任務接口表(INTER_WCS_TASK)主關鍵字。②源貨位地址resaddre,定義字段類型為Varchar(20),周轉箱出庫操作中源貨位地址為揀貨貨位地址;庫存盤點操作中源貨位地址為盤點貨位地址,不為空值。③源貨位入口resport,定義字段類型為Varchar(6),周轉箱出庫操作中源貨位入口為揀貨貨位對應的出口;庫存盤點操作中源貨位入口沒有意義,為空值。④作業操作類型optype,定義字段類型為varchar(5),BO:周轉箱出庫PD:庫存盤點。出庫數量quant,定義字段類型為Int,接收接口表(INTER_WMS_TASK)中的quant值。⑤實際出庫數量backquant,定義字段類型為Int,回傳時為實際出庫數量。⑥揀貨完成finish,定義字段類型為varchar(5),0值表示完成,1值表示周轉箱有漏揀任務行,在彈出口揀貨完成后,接口表(INTER_WCS_TASK)會輸入1值,回傳接口表(INTER_WMS_TASK),從而進行下一彈出口揀選。

(3)分揀信息。①揀貨員IDUserid,定義字段類型為Varchar(20),回傳為實際操作登陸人員ID號。②客戶IDcustomerid,定義字段類型為Varchar(20),接收(INTER_WCS_TASK)任務表下傳內容。③派送路徑或區域Sendkind,定義字段類型為Varchar(20),該字段在進行路徑分揀時不存在,接收(INTER_WCS_TASK)任務表下傳內容,關聯分揀道口,從而控制分揀裝置。

3.3 任務完成表定義

WMS與WCS進行信息數據交互過程中,任務完成需要進行確認,有必要對狀態進行數據表項任務完成表(INTER_FINISH)定義:

(1)任務編號taskid,定義字段類型為Varchar(10),為主關鍵字段。

(2)任務執行狀態Status,定義字段類型為Varchar(1),為主關鍵字段,1值表示手動注冊完成(此時taskid為注冊周轉箱號碼),2值表示揀貨完成(此時taskid為波次任務編號),3值表示復核完成(此時taskid為周轉箱號碼)。

4 結語

通過分析WMS與WCS間的數據交換,并且針對出庫情況下,詳細定義WMS下傳WCS與WCS上傳WMS的數據主要表項內容,但沒有對倉儲入庫、補貨、盤點、復核打包作業以及配置自動化庫AS/RS、自動導引小車AGV等其他自動化設備的情況進行分析,其次,關于數據接口的調用程序沒有進行構架分析,這為以后進一步研究提供了方向。

[1]徐躍明.WCS軟件在自動倉儲系統中的應用[J].物流技術與應用,2008,(6):102-104.

[2]彭麟,邵海龍,張勝,等.基于Webservice的WMS與ERP系統接口技術的研究[J].物流技術與應用,2015,(10):184-187.

[3]田雅芳,梁文靜.自動化倉儲管理系統與企業MES系統集成的設計與實現[J].物流工程與管理,2011,(3):61-62.

[4]趙炯,王琮,唐亮.WMS系統與SAP系統之間數據交換技術研究[J].物流技術,2005,(7):40-43.

[5]馬殷元,蔣兆遠.大型貨物柔性輸送及處理自動化控制系統[J].控制工程,2011,(9):734-736.

[6]蘇秀麗,錢琳琳,寇玉民.工業信息網絡在傳送帶控制中的構建及應用[J].控制工程,2009,(9):95-101.

Structural Design of Interactive Data between WMS and WCS

Yang Jufeng,Zhang Zhijie,Yan Rui
(Yuncheng University,Yuncheng 044000,China)

In this paper,we went over the interactive processes between the WMS with automatic transport and sorting lines,handheld RF sorting terminals and e-label aided sorting DPS system,and the WCS.Then we proceeded to define the information interface.More specifically,we first identified the content of the interactive information concerning the turnover carton/pallet unit,picking task and sorting,etc.,and then analyzed and defined the designation,type,input and function,etc.,of the fields in the interactive task data table concerning the downloading of WMS data to WCS,reloading of WCS data to WMS and the data interaction between the two,etc.

WMS;WCS;interactive interface;data task table

F253.9

A

1005-152X(2017)06-0161-04

10.3969/j.issn.1005-152X.2017.06.038

2017-05-01

運城學院院級科研項目(xk-2014013);運城市2014年重點建設項目“亨通醫藥物流配送中心項目”

楊巨峰(1984-),男,山西運城人,運城學院講師,研究方向:現代倉儲規劃設計與管理、倉儲設備與技術、物流信息系統。

猜你喜歡
定義數據庫信息
訂閱信息
中華手工(2017年2期)2017-06-06 23:00:31
數據庫
財經(2017年2期)2017-03-10 14:35:35
數據庫
財經(2016年15期)2016-06-03 07:38:02
數據庫
財經(2016年3期)2016-03-07 07:44:46
成功的定義
山東青年(2016年1期)2016-02-28 14:25:25
數據庫
財經(2016年6期)2016-02-24 07:41:51
展會信息
中外會展(2014年4期)2014-11-27 07:46:46
修辭學的重大定義
當代修辭學(2014年3期)2014-01-21 02:30:44
山的定義
公務員文萃(2013年5期)2013-03-11 16:08:37
教你正確用(十七)
海外英語(2006年11期)2006-11-30 05:16:56
主站蜘蛛池模板: 国产网友愉拍精品视频| 日韩区欧美国产区在线观看| 国产福利一区视频| 国产小视频在线高清播放| 亚洲美女一区| 在线国产毛片| 国产欧美日韩免费| 欧美第二区| 国产乱人伦精品一区二区| 午夜a视频| 九色在线观看视频| 国产精品福利一区二区久久| 国产精品女人呻吟在线观看| 91精品国产综合久久不国产大片| 中文成人无码国产亚洲| 国产麻豆91网在线看| 国产麻豆精品在线观看| 国产精品手机视频一区二区| 一级全黄毛片| 无码中字出轨中文人妻中文中| 久久亚洲国产视频| 国产精品自在在线午夜| 亚洲无码熟妇人妻AV在线| 国产嫖妓91东北老熟女久久一| 欧美在线一二区| 国产精品美人久久久久久AV| 欧美日韩国产在线播放| 在线欧美a| 亚洲国产成人麻豆精品| 青青草原国产一区二区| 狠狠亚洲婷婷综合色香| 国产精品亚洲va在线观看| 欧美亚洲国产精品久久蜜芽| 最新加勒比隔壁人妻| 国产在线拍偷自揄观看视频网站| 欧美激情视频一区二区三区免费| 四虎影视库国产精品一区| 亚洲欧美人成电影在线观看| 99热国产这里只有精品无卡顿"| 丁香综合在线| 国产经典在线观看一区| 视频国产精品丝袜第一页| 夜夜爽免费视频| 一级毛片在线直接观看| 欧洲欧美人成免费全部视频| 亚洲无码视频一区二区三区| 欧美精品在线观看视频| 国产性生交xxxxx免费| 99国产精品国产高清一区二区| 97色伦色在线综合视频| 高潮爽到爆的喷水女主播视频 | 黄片在线永久| 成年人免费国产视频| 亚洲AⅤ综合在线欧美一区| 99在线国产| 欧美a在线| 免费一级无码在线网站| 5555国产在线观看| 久久福利片| 五月天香蕉视频国产亚| 精品久久久久成人码免费动漫| 亚洲区欧美区| 88国产经典欧美一区二区三区| 2021国产精品自拍| 亚洲va精品中文字幕| 伊人久久久久久久久久| 国产新AV天堂| 久久一本日韩精品中文字幕屁孩| 一级做a爰片久久免费| 在线免费看黄的网站| 免费看美女自慰的网站| 亚洲va在线∨a天堂va欧美va| 国产视频一区二区在线观看 | 91丨九色丨首页在线播放| 2021国产在线视频| 精品视频一区在线观看| 中文无码精品a∨在线观看| 久久综合色88| 国内精品小视频在线| 国产91视频免费观看| 找国产毛片看| 久久香蕉国产线|